[Bf-blender-cvs] [0a667c66142] functions: cleanup
Jacques Lucke
noreply at git.blender.org
Tue Nov 26 17:32:09 CET 2019
Commit: 0a667c661423f5025e5bd4e5c21858d02049fd84
Author: Jacques Lucke
Date: Tue Nov 26 17:12:06 2019 +0100
Branches: functions
https://developer.blender.org/rB0a667c661423f5025e5bd4e5c21858d02049fd84
cleanup
===================================================================
M source/blender/blenkernel/intern/inlined_node_tree.cc
===================================================================
diff --git a/source/blender/blenkernel/intern/inlined_node_tree.cc b/source/blender/blenkernel/intern/inlined_node_tree.cc
index 68008b7f645..41f9e3ef3c1 100644
--- a/source/blender/blenkernel/intern/inlined_node_tree.cc
+++ b/source/blender/blenkernel/intern/inlined_node_tree.cc
@@ -92,6 +92,17 @@ InlinedNodeTree::~InlinedNodeTree()
}
}
+void XNode::destruct_with_sockets()
+{
+ for (XInputSocket *socket : m_inputs) {
+ socket->~XInputSocket();
+ }
+ for (XOutputSocket *socket : m_outputs) {
+ socket->~XOutputSocket();
+ }
+ this->~XNode();
+}
+
InlinedNodeTree::InlinedNodeTree(bNodeTree *btree, BTreeVTreeMap &vtrees) : m_btree(btree)
{
SCOPED_TIMER(__func__);
@@ -121,17 +132,6 @@ BLI_NOINLINE void InlinedNodeTree::expand_groups(Vector<XNode *> &all_nodes,
}
}
-void XNode::destruct_with_sockets()
-{
- for (XInputSocket *socket : m_inputs) {
- socket->~XInputSocket();
- }
- for (XOutputSocket *socket : m_outputs) {
- socket->~XOutputSocket();
- }
- this->~XNode();
-}
-
void InlinedNodeTree::expand_group_node(XNode &group_node,
Vector<XNode *> &all_nodes,
Vector<XGroupInput *> &all_group_inputs,
More information about the Bf-blender-cvs
mailing list